In this page, you will read about how you can study abroad after a rejected visa and what the reapplication strategies that actually work.<\/p>\n\n\n\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-top-reasons-student-visas-get-rejected-nbsp\"><span id=\"top-reasons-student-visas-get-rejected\">Top Reasons Student Visas Get Rejected&nbsp;<\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Understanding why student visas gets rejected helps you fix the real mistake in your application instead of wild guessing. Visa officers evaluate applications based on strict criteria that are defined by immigration authorities. Here, we have listed some of the <a href=\"https:\/\/leverageedu.com\/learn\/student-visa-rejection-reasons\/\"><strong>common reasons for a student visa rejection<\/strong><\/a>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-financial-issues\"><span id=\"financial-issues\">Financial Issues<\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Here are some of the major financial issues that can impact your visa application.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>1. Financial Insufficiency: <\/strong>One of the top reasons for student visa refusals is inadequate financial proof, which is seen as the inability to support your studies and stay abroad.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2. <strong>Bank balance mismatch<\/strong>: If the bank statement does not show the required minimum funds for the visa approval, then the embassies often reject the application.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>3. <strong>Sponsor credibility<\/strong>: If the funds are coming from family or sponsors, then it must be backed by legible relationship proof, stable income documents, and reliable financial history to improve your chances of visa success.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>4. <strong>Education loan timing issues<\/strong>: Loans that are approved during visa application or after application submission may be seen as last-minute fixes, which can lead to visa refusal.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Note:<\/strong> Visa officers clearly list \u201cinsufficient funds\u201d as an official concern, especially in countries like the UK, Canada, and Australia.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-sop-amp-intent-credibility-issues\"><span id=\"sop-intent-credibility-issues\">SOP &amp; Intent Credibility Issues<\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>The Statement of Purpose (SOP) is a major part of your visa application. A weak SOP can often mean confusion or lack of clarity in intent. Look at the SOP-related issues that can lead to visa refusal<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1. <strong>Generic SOPs<\/strong>: Copying templates or generic statements without any personal context makes it difficult for visa officers to understand your profile. It can have a negative impact on your visa application.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2. <strong>Weak career logic<\/strong>: If your chosen course does not logically connect with your past academics or future career goals, ten visa officers may question your real purpose for studying abroad.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>3. <strong>Country-hopping red flags<\/strong><br>Applying to multiple countries or unrelated courses can be seen as a red flag in a visa application and can lead to rejections.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-academic-amp-course-mismatch\"><span id=\"academic-course-mismatch\">Academic &amp; Course Mismatch<\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Partial or poor academic alignment is another official reason for visa rejection. Here are some of the common reasons under this section: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1. <strong>Sudden field changes<\/strong>: Switching to a completely unrelated discipline without a clear reason can make officers doubt your intent.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2. <strong>Regressive academic choices<\/strong><br>If your new course level looks like a step down academically without any clear reason, it can be seen as suspicious and can lead to visa refusal.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-documentation-amp-technical-errors\"><span id=\"documentation-technical-errors\">Documentation &amp; Technical Errors<\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Documents are a major part of the visa application, and even a small mistake can lead to refusal. Look at some of the documentation and technical errors to look into your visa application.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1. <strong>Incorrect formats<\/strong>: Visa forms, certificates, and bank statements must follow strict formatting rules. If not, officers may treat them as invalid.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2. <strong>Expired statements<\/strong>: Bank statements or passports that do not meet validity requirements can lead to visa refusals.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>3. <strong>Translation issues<\/strong>: Documents that are not translated correctly lead to automatic rejections in many countries.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-pale-ocean-gradient-background has-background\"><strong>Also Read: <\/strong><a href=\"https:\/\/leverageedu.com\/learn\/what-to-do-after-student-visa-rejection\/\"><strong>What to do if Your Student Visa Gets Rejected?<\/strong><\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-things-not-to-do-after-a-visa-rejection-nbsp\"><span id=\"things-not-to-do-after-a-visa-rejection\">Things Not to Do After a Visa Rejection&nbsp;<\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>A visa rejection is not the end of your journey, but you have to make sure that you do not repeat the same mistakes in your reapplication that led to refusal. Below are the most common mistakes that lead to repeated visa rejection.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1. <strong>Reapplying Without Any Changes<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Submitting the same profile again, hoping for a different result, does not work. Visa officers compare past and current applications closely, and if nothing has changed, the outcome will be the same as before.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2. <strong>Using the Same SOP<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>This is one of the biggest visa reapplication mistakes that most of the studnts makes durig the visa reapplication. If your visa is refused due to the statement of purpose, then do make some changes instead of using the same SOP again.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>3. <strong>Ignoring Refusal Notes<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Most countries provide refusal reasons or notes after the visa rejection. Ignoring these points and still making the same mistake can lead to weak reapplications.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>4. <strong>Switching Countries Impulsively<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Changing countries just because of a rejection can backfire. Without fixing financial, academic, or intent issues, a new country often leads to the same rejection outcome as before.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-when-can-you-reapply-after-a-student-visa-rejection\"><span id=\"when-can-you-reapply-after-a-student-visa-rejection\">When Can You Reapply After a Student Visa Rejection?<\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>There is no universal waiting period to reapply for the student visa after rejection. Make sure to do some meaningful changes in your visa before reapplying. Below, we have mentioned the average period that students wait before reapplying for the visa.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-table is-style-stripes\"><table class=\"has-fixed-layout\"><tbody><tr><td><strong>Country<\/strong><\/td><td><strong>Minimum Gap<\/strong><\/td><td><strong>Recommended Gap<\/strong><\/td><\/tr><tr><td>USA<\/td><td>Immediate<\/td><td>3\u20136 months<\/td><\/tr><tr><td>UK<\/td><td>Immediate<\/td><td>2\u20134 weeks<\/td><\/tr><tr><td>Canada<\/td><td>Immediate<\/td><td>2\u20133 months<\/td><\/tr><tr><td>Australia<\/td><td>Immediate<\/td><td>1\u20133 months<\/td><\/tr><tr><td>Germany<\/td><td>Immediate<\/td><td>2\u20133 months<\/td><\/tr><\/tbody><\/table><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Note<\/strong>: Immediate reapplication is allowed in most countries, but applying without fixing issues can increase risk.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-reapplication-strategy-that-actually-works-nbsp\"><span id=\"reapplication-strategy-that-actually-works\">Reapplication Strategy That Actually Works&nbsp;<\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Before applying for the visa, fixing the previous issue can help improve the outcome. Here are some of the strategies that work for a successful visa application.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-financial-reset-strategy\"><span id=\"financial-reset-strategy\">Financial Reset Strategy<\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>If your visa is causing an issue due to financial factors, then here are some of the strategies that can work for you.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1. <strong>How much balance increase matters<\/strong>: A minor increase rarely helps in changing the outcome. Officers expect to see an increase above minimum requirements as stated in the immigration policies.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2. <strong>Education loan vs savings logic<\/strong>: Well-documented education loans often carry more credibility than sudden cash deposits.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>3. Sponsor restructuring<\/strong>: If the sponsor&#8217;s income or relationship was weak earlier, changing or strengthening the sponsor documentation can improve outcomes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-sop-rewriting-logic-nbsp\"><span id=\"sop-rewriting-logic\">SOP Rewriting Logic&nbsp;<\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>A weak SOP can clearly affect your visa success. If your SOP is weak, then make sure to do the given changes in it.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1. <strong>Career progression clarity<\/strong>: Explain why you chose this course and how it fits your background. A clear logical answer can help you a long way in visa success<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2<strong>. Country justification<\/strong>: Officers want to know why you chose that specific country over others, and a clear answer will help you in your visa success.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>3. <strong>Return intent framing<\/strong>: Even if long-term settlement is possible, your SOP must clearly explain short-term academic intent and career plans.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-academic-course-correction\"><span id=\"academic-course-correction\">Academic Course Correction<\/span><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>IF the academic section was one of your weak points in vis application, then making a change in the academic course section can improve your visa success rate.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1. <strong>Same country vs different country<\/strong>: Reapplying to the same country works if issues are fixed. Changing countries only helps when it aligns better with your profile.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2. <strong>Same university vs new university<\/strong><br>A different university with a better course that fits your academic background can lower risk by improving credibility to make your reapplication a success.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>3. <strong>Intake shift logic<\/strong>: Switching from a competitive intake to a less crowded one can help only if academic and financial logic improves.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-pale-ocean-gradient-background has-background\"><strong>Also Read: <\/strong><a href=\"https:\/\/leverageedu.com\/learn\/student-visa-rejection-analysis\/\"><strong>Student Visa Rejection Analysis<\/strong><\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-does-a-visa-rejection-affect-future-applications\"><span id=\"does-a-visa-rejection-affect-future-applications\">Does a Visa Rejection Affect Future Applications?<\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>A visa rejection can feel like a big obstacle in your study abroad journey, but it does not permanently damage your chances of studying abroad. The only thing that matters is how the rejection is handled and what changes are made before reapplying.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Short-Term Impact<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>In the short term, a recent visa rejection puts your next application under closer verification. Visa officers will carefully compare your new application with the previous one to check whether the issues have been genuinely addressed or not.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Risk of Multiple Refusals<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Multiple refusals can raise red flags. Repeated visa rejections often suggest that the applicant is either not understanding visa requirements or is reapplying without meaningful changes. can raise red flags and weaken credibility by making future applications harder.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Are Visa Refusals Shared Between Countries?<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Most countries do not automatically share visa refusal data. However, students are required to declare previous refusals in new applications. Providing false information or hiding past rejections can lead to serious consequences, including long-term bans.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-faqs\"><span id=\"faqs\">FAQS<\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<div class=\"schema-faq wp-block-yoast-faq-block\"><div class=\"schema-faq-section\" id=\"faq-question-1767703209195\"><strong class=\"schema-faq-question\">Can I apply again if my student visa is rejected?<\/strong> <p class=\"schema-faq-answer\">Yes, you can apply again after a student visa rejection.
